Cars in Black
The total number of cars in Black is 156, which amounts to 1.7 vehicles for every person who commutes by car.
In 2006, there were 0 auto theft crimes reported in Black.
Working and Commuting
6 women and 8 men in Black are professional drivers. Together they make up 14% of the Black work force.
94 people (47% of the population) in Black work. 1 work from home, and 93 commute. The median income for the year 2000 was $17,130.
99% of all commuters in Black ride in a car. People who commute in Black typically spend twenty to twenty-four minutes getting to work.
